  3. "How We Roll" is the only single by late American rapper Big Pun from his posthumous compilation album, Endangered Species (2001). It features production by Irv Gotti and guest vocals by his protégé Ashanti , who performs the chorus and outro.

    Early life. Fat Joe was born Joseph Antonio Cartagena in the Bronx borough of New York City, where he was raised by parents of Puerto Rican and Cuban descent. Living in the Forest Houses, a public housing project in the South Bronx neighborhood of Morrisania, Fat Joe began stealing at a young age to support his family. He also admits that he was a bully in his childhood.
